Northeast-10 Player of the Week

Adrian Schippers, Southern New Hampshire (Jr., F, Ashby, Mass.) - Had a hand in all four goals for the Penmen in a 2-0 week. Totaled two goals and an assist in a 3-0 win over Caldwell and assisted on the lone goal in a 1-0 win over C.W. Post.

Northeast-10 Goalkeeper of the Week

Sean Lambert, Southern New Hampshire (Sr., GK, Rehoboth, Mass.) - Did not allow a goal in 170:30 of action in a 2-0 week. Went the distance to earn a shutout against C.W. Post, then stopped one shot without allowing a goal in a 3-0 win over Caldwell.

Northeast-10 Freshman of the Week

Robbie Sabadoz, Merrimack (Fr., F, Ottawa, Ontario) - Tallied three goals and an assist in his first two collegiate games, leading the team to two victories at the Doubletree Classic. Scored both goals in the 2-1 win versus Felician.
